Oliver Fire Protection & Security is a privately held, full-service life safety provider serving the Northeast Corridor. Founded in 1957, Oliver has distinguished itself as one of the most respected life safety providers in its territory by placing a high emphasis on delivering quality solutions while exceeding customer expectations. We help protect lives and property through industry-leading fire protection, life safety, and security solutions, and we’re committed to safety, customer service, teamwork, and creating long-term career opportunities for our employees.
We’re seeking an experienced Billing Department Supervisor to lead and support our centralized billing team. In this role, you’ll oversee billing operations for Inspections, Alarm Service, Sprinkler Service, special invoicing, ISNet maintenance, and related billing activities. This position plays an important role in ensuring invoices are accurate, timely, and consistent while improving processes, reducing billing backlogs, supporting cash flow, and helping teams work more efficiently across the organization.
This is a leadership role ideal for someone with service-based billing experience, strong process management skills, and a team-first approach.
- Supervise, mentor, and develop billing department team members while setting clear expectations and accountability standards.
- Lead regular one-on-one meetings, support annual performance reviews, and cross-train team members to ensure coverage and continuity.
- Oversee daily billing activity for Sprinkler Service, Inspection Repairs, Alarm Service, Service Contract Billings, Inspection Services, special/complex invoicing, ISNet maintenance, and subcontract billing.
- Ensure invoices are processed accurately and in accordance with customer contract requirements.
- Monitor billing queues, workloads, unbilled work, and backlog reports to support established turnaround goals and company cash flow objectives.
- Review and approve complex or high-value invoices and ensure required supporting documentation is complete.
- Develop standardized billing procedures and identify ways to streamline workflows, reduce errors, and improve efficiency.
- Partner with Operations, Sales, Service, Finance, Accounts Receivable, Inspections, and Project Management teams to improve communication and invoice accuracy.
- Track and report department KPIs, investigate billing discrepancies, and help resolve customer disputes or collection issues related to invoice accuracy.
- Serve as the primary escalation point for billing-related concerns, customer billing portals, audits, and documentation requests.
